A pillar of strength in your warehouse. But what types of warehouse shelving are available? And which one is suitable for you? For palletised goods, Jungheinrich pallet racking is ideal; for a variety of small, different items, small parts racking is the first choice.
What types of pallet shelving are available? The most common types are multi-bay rackings for wide aisles and narrow aisles which can also be flexibly configured for heavy bay loads of up to 45 t. Jungheinrich also offers compact racking for particularly space-saving storage. The range also includes high-bay racking, which allows you to make optimum use of your room height.
Our portfolio includes a wide range of systems and racking types that comply with the relevant DIN standards and meet the highest quality requirements. A distinction is made between static and dynamic storage forms.

Do you deal with a large quantity of small items? Or are you looking for efficient order picking solutions? If so, small parts racking is the answer. A popular solution is racking shelving, which can also be converted into space-saving high-bay racking.
A small parts rack must have a clear organisational principle and allow you quick access to each individual item. This is the only way to ensure that order picking, for example, runs quickly.
